Hey all so i have finally begun my first build. I'm starting my build with a Dell Vostro 460, the reason for this is... well it was just easier for me then just going out and buying separate parts well for me anyway.

 

so first up:

the first thing i did when i pulled out this computer from the old studie (now just a storage room) i pulled it apart so everything is out. i went ahead and blew all of the dust out of the case with my trusty air compressor and found five dead flys and a very much alive red back spider (if you dont know what this is google it) so once i cleaned out the case i moved to the mother board and fans ok fans first i blew as much dustr as i could with the air compressor but there was still some residue left behind that was stuck there (mabye due to static electricity) anyway i found some old q tips and %90 percent isopropal alchohol and cleaned them down all two of them including the cpu fan after this i ccleaned uop the mother after taking the ram out and the took off the cpu cooler and cleaned that aswell as replacing the thermal paste with 'High Performace Cooler Master ' paste (pea methord used) then i opened up the power suply and blew away all the bunnys and put it back together.
